Introduction to Java using IBM WebSphere Studio Application Developer
Course Description
This course covers the Java programming language and WebSphere Studio Application Developer Java Integrated Development Environment. Students are introduced to the fundamental concepts of the Java programming language including the language syntas and core class libraries, such as I/O, String classes, and collections.

Class Length
5 days

Objectives
  • Build projects, packages, and classes using WebSphere Application Developer
  • Use the Application Developer browsers and help utility to explore the JDK documentation and browse class libraries
  • Debug with Application Developer
  • Handle exceptions and test your code
  • Use Java collection classes
  • Use serialization, streams and threads
  • Use the code management in Application Developer

Who will benefit from this course
Programmers, Software Developers

Prerequisites
Application development and sound software programming experience

Course Outline
  • Best practices for Java code development
  • Effective use of the IBM WebSphere Studio Application Developer tool
